Summary of the Polish Driving License Test
The driving license test in Poland consists of two main parts: a theoretical examination and a useful driving test. Each part tests different abilities and knowledge, making sure that prospects understand both the guidelines of the road and the useful aspects of driving.
Table 1: Components of the Polish Driving License TestComponentDescriptionDurationTheoretical TestA composed or digital examination covering traffic laws, road indications, and safe driving practices.30-45 minutesPractical TestAn evaluation of driving abilities on the roadway with an examiner.40-60 minutesThe Theoretical Test
The theoretical test is developed to examine a prospect’s understanding of road rules, indications, and guidelines. It consists of multiple-choice concerns that require a comprehensive understanding of traffic laws, safe driving practices, and emergency procedures.

The Practical Test
As soon as a prospect passes the theoretical test, they can arrange their useful driving exam. This test examines their ability to operate a vehicle securely and effectively.

Q3: How much does it cost to take the driving license test in Poland?
A3: The expenses can vary however normally consist of:
Driving course costs: PLN 1,800 to PLN 3,000Theoretical test fee: PLN 30Dry run charge: PLN 140Q4: How many efforts are enabled to pass the driving test?
A4: Candidates can take the theoretical or practical test multiple times; however, they must pay the exam charge for each attempt.
Q5: How long is a Polish driving license legitimate?
A5: A Polish driving license is generally valid for 15 years. After this duration, it must be renewed; this procedure needs a brand-new medical exam.
